Being able to speak, use language and communicate with others is one of the basic necessities for happiness and success.

I CAN works to support the development of speech, language and communication skills in all children with a special focus on those who find this hard: children with speech, language and communication needs.

The Communication Trust Conference

The Communication Trust Conference, on Friday 10 October 2008, aims to provide an opportunity to explore the issue of workforce development in the context of speech, language and communication (SLC) for primary aged children (including the transition into primary school).

I CAN welcomes Bercow

I CAN welcomes the final recommendations of the Bercow Review of services for Children and Young People (0-19) with Speech, Language and Communication Needs (SLCN).
